Job Description

Department Pre Operative Care Unit Job Summary The Multi-Skilled Technician is an experienced healthcare worker who provides both patient care and administrative support. This position is in Pre Operative Services.
Workdays/Shift/Start Time:
Fulltime hours: 1st shift, Mon-Fri from 05:00am-1:30pm, 5-8 hour shifts.
Salary Details:
Hourly rate is determined by years of experience relating to this role and internal equity within organization. Minimum rate starting at $20.00, max of salary range is $28.20. Required Qualifications
  • Require one of the following: 1.
) Florida licensure as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A), Emergency Medical Technician (EMT), or Paramedic, or a military Hospital Corpsman, Combat Medic Specialist, or Aerospace Medical Service Specialist; or National licensure as an Emergency Medical Technician (EMT); which must be maintained active during employment; or 2.) Nursing students who are eligible for CNA exam are required to: a.) currently be enrolled in an accredited school of Nursing (RN/LPN); b.) have completed the first semester of clinical for ASN/BSN degree or completion of first trimester for LPN; c.) cannot be currently licensed in the U.S. as a RN or LPN; and d) Nurse/Practical Nurse Graduate who is eligible and/or scheduled to sit for the NCLEX exam within 12 months of hire date; or 3.) Patient Care Technician (PCT) or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A)
Certification:
Provide certification of successful completion of a Florida State Board approved program and successfully obtain a Florida CNA license within 120 days of graduation.
